Iridium Cube Applications

  • Scientific Research & Calibration: Used as density standards in physics labs (22.56 g/cm3)
  • High-Temperature Experiments: Crucibles or heat shields in material science (melting point 2466℃)
  • Industrial Tooling: Wear-resistant components in extreme environments
  • Aerospace: Ballast weights in satellites due to high density
  • Medical Devices: Radiation shielding in oncology equipment
  • Education: Demonstration of rare metal properties in chemistry classes

Iridium Properties

ElementValue
Atomic number77
Crystal structureFace centred cubic
Electronic structureXe 4f¹⁴ 5d⁷ 6s²
Valences shown3, 4
Atomic weight( amu )192.22
Thermal neutron absorption cross-section( Barns )425
Photo-electric work function( eV )4.6
Natural isotope distribution( Mass No./% )191/ 37.3
Natural isotope distribution( Mass No./% )193/ 62.7
Atomic radius – Goldschmidt( nm )0.135
ElementValue
Material conditionSoft
Material conditionHard
Poisson’s ratio0.26
Poisson’s ratio0.26
Bulk modulus( GPa )371
Bulk modulus( GPa )371
Tensile modulus( GPa )528
Tensile modulus( GPa )528
Hardness – Vickers( kgf mm⁻² )650
Hardness – Vickers( kgf mm⁻² )200-300
Tensile strength( MPa )550-1100
Tensile strength( MPa )1200
ElementValue
Electrical resistivity( µOhmcm )5.1@20@20°C
Superconductivity critical temperature( K )0.11
Temperature coefficient( K⁻¹ )0.0045@0-100°C
Thermal emf against Pt (cold 0C – hot 100C)( mV )0.65
ElementValue
Boiling point( C )4130
Density( gcm⁻³ )22.4@20°C
ElementValue
Melting point( C )2410
Latent heat of evaporation( J g⁻¹ )3186
Latent heat of fusion( J g⁻¹ )135
Specific heat( J K⁻¹ kg⁻¹ )133@25°C
Thermal conductivity( W m⁻¹ K⁻¹ )147@0-100°C
Coefficient of thermal expansion( x10⁻⁶ K⁻¹ )6.8@0-100°C

Iridium cubes are primarily used for scientific research, high-temperature experiments, and as calibration standards due to their extreme density and stability.

Our iridium cubes are 99.95% pure minimum, with optional 99.99% purity for specialized applications.

Pure iridium cubes are weakly paramagnetic, but generally considered non-magnetic for most applications.
